Fix our broken healthcare system

Hospital and healthcare administration: Top administrators should have medical degrees and backgrounds. CEOs, COOs etc with business and financial degrees will always put profit over patients. Our healthcare system is broken because it is viewed and managed as a business. There is a huge disconnect between administration and the clinical staff. We must put patients first. Give the decision making back to the medical professionals. Large healthcare companies with CEOs who received multi million dollar bonuses during COVID while I was frontline in the ICU reusing the same single use n95 and sanitizing and reusing my single use CAPR face shield for weeks need to be investigated. We need a healthcare system where the ones making the decisions are the ones with their hands on the patients. Put the CARE back in healthcare!
